 [2002-01-28 02:27 UTC] taufikp at yahoo dot com
After upgrading from PHP 4.0.6 to 4.1.1, my Apache (v1.3.22) can't load the DLL anymore.

I have deleted _all_ PHP 4.0.6 files (including all files in windows/system directory) before installing the new version.

This is the message I got:
Cannot load c:/php/sapi/php4apache.dll into server: (31) A device attached to the system is not functioning:

But when I installed the old version of PHP, my Apache can load the DLL smoothly.

Can somebody please help?

 [2002-01-28 10:31 UTC] sander@php.net
Ask support questions on the appropriate mailinglist.

Hint: you need to copy the new php4ts.dll to your windows\system (Win9x) winnt\system32 (WinNT/2K) or windows\system32 (XP) directory.
